The building at 525 Cooper Street, also known as the Charles S. Boyer Building, is a professional building in the city of Camden in Camden County, New Jersey, United States. It was built in 1925 and was added to the National Register of Historic Places on August 24, 1990, for its significance in architecture and law.[3] The building is part of the Banks, Insurance, and Legal Buildings in Camden, New Jersey, 1873–1938 Multiple Property Submission (MPS).[4]
